Crank window replacement services involve removing outdated or damaged crank-operated windows and installing new, functional units. This process typically includes carefully removing the existing window frame and sash, inspecting the surrounding structure for any issues, and then fitting a new window that operates smoothly. The goal is to restore the window’s functionality while improving energy efficiency and enhancing the overall appearance of the property. These services are often performed by experienced contractors who ensure that the new window fits securely and functions properly, providing long-lasting performance.
Many homeowners seek crank window replacement to address common problems such as difficulty opening or closing the window, drafts, or leaks. Over time, window components can become worn or broken, leading to decreased insulation and increased energy costs. Additionally, damaged or outdated crank windows may no longer lock securely, compromising security. Replacing these windows can eliminate drafts, reduce noise, and improve the comfort of indoor spaces. Service providers can also help upgrade older windows to more modern, durable options that require less maintenance and offer better insulation.

The overview below groups typical Crank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kokomo,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or crank window repairs or replacements in Kokomo, IN, range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, covering tasks like replacing handles or fixing minor hardware issues.
Standard Replacement - Full replacement of a standard crank window often costs between $600 and $1,200. Most projects in this range involve replacing an entire window with a similar size and style, handled frequently by local contractors.
Larger or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ex window replacements, such as custom sizes or multiple units, can range from $1,200 to $3,000 or more. These projects are less common but may involve additional structural work or specialty features.
Full Home Window Overhaul - Complete window overhaul for multiple rooms or an entire property can reach $5,000 or higher. Such extensive projects are less frequent and typically involve significant customization or renovation efforts by local pros.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
